Urban Air Adventure Park is a modern indoor adventure and trampoline park located in the northern part of Fort Worth, Texas, USA. This popular center is designed for active family recreation and offers an impressive range of activities for visitors of all ages, where everyone from toddlers to adults can find something to enjoy and get a boost of positive emotions.

What to Do

Urban Air Adventure Park in Fort Worth offers visitors a kaleidoscope of exciting activities for all ages. It's a place where everyone can find something they enjoy, from thrill-seekers to families with young children. The park prides itself on unique attractions that provide unforgettable experiences and an adrenaline rush.

One of the park's main highlights is the world's first indoor skydive tunnel designed for simulating skydiving. Here, you can experience the incredible feeling of freefall without needing to jump out of a plane! Additionally, visitors can take an exhilarating flight on the Sky Rider zipline, which soars over the park, allowing you to see all the attractions from above. For those who enjoy testing their agility and coordination, there is a ropes course with various difficulty levels and the fun Wipeout zone, where you must dodge rotating obstacles.

Beyond these flagship attractions, Urban Air features spacious trampoline arenas for jumping to your heart's content, various obstacle courses to test strength and endurance, and other interactive zones that keep both kids and adults entertained. The park is also perfect for hosting birthdays, corporate events, and family celebrations, offering special packages and programs.

Urban Air places a special emphasis on creating a safe and comfortable environment for all guests. Special events are held regularly, such as the "Jumperoo" program designed for the youngest visitors and Sensory-Friendly Hours for guests with sensory processing sensitivities. The park encourages active play, exploration of new possibilities, and team building, making every visit not only fun but also beneficial.

Working Hours

Urban Air Adventure Park in Fort Worth typically operates on a regular schedule but also offers special hours for specific programs. For instance, the Jumperoo program for toddlers is held on Fridays from 9:00 AM to 12:00 PM after summer break ends. Also, after the summer season, Sensory-Friendly Hours are held on Mondays from 2:00 PM to 4:00 PM, providing a calmer environment for children with special needs.
